What are the responsibilities and job description for the Administrative Services Coordinator III (100387) position at Honda?
JOB PURPOSE
The Operations Administrator is the person who handles Budget, Data management, and Coordination/Logistical tasks in the Department to enable Projects to maneuverer smoothly knowing that communication is following proper channels, database systems are populated with latest information, activity is following the proper flow, and schedule milestones are at the fore front of thinking when decisions are being made. Department exclusive and unique tasks to support Business & Product Planning Division are also necessary. This is a key behind-the-scenes person making sure the gears are in-sync and working according to plan.
K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ES
Budget Management:
- Promote appropriate fiscal controls and processes for department operations.
- Track departmental spending and update actuals regularly.
- Ensure budget adherence and provide regular financial reports to management.
- Coordinate Department Unit summarization and resource planning discussion and support Department Lead with reporting data.
- Promote and enforce data management best practices within the department for internal and external data customers.
- Organize and manage data flow within the department.
- Coordinate the dissemination of information to relevant stakeholders.
- Maintain Centralized database of departmental information.
- Grant and remove access to users, ensure data security & integrity.
- Assist Department Lead and Project LPL to mature and circulate SOWs (Statement of Work) and MSLs (Master Services Agreement) to procure necessary stakeholders signatures so that work with vendors and consultants can proceed according to schedule and meet expected results.
- Provide logistical support for department members accessing other Honda facilities.
- Determine appropriate points of contact to support visiting Honda and external guests as well as unique project requirements.
- Coordinate travel arrangements and access permissions as required.
- Assess and deliver project requirements for unique activities that communicate the value of department and center activities. This includes, but is not limited to, coordinating with project leaders and management, securing assets and resources, and navigating potential schedule conflict while assessing priority between normal operations and special activities.

QUALIFICATIONS, EXPERIENCE, & SKILLS
- Strong organizational skills and adaptable mindset.
- Excellent communication, both verbal and written
- Proficiency in database and information management systems
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team
Minimum Educational Qualifications
- Bachelors degree in relevant field
Minimum Experience
- 5 years proven experience in budget management and data organization
Working Conditions
- Mostly working at desk.
